Our research program (MPhil/PhD) enables you to conduct thorough, critical investigations in workplace studies, employment relations, HR management, and organizational behavior with guidance from specialist advisors.

The MPhil/PhD curriculum requires creating significant original research within your selected discipline. Differing from structured degree programs, this qualification emphasizes independent investigation and novel contributions to academic knowledge. Initial coursework develops sophisticated research capabilities for collecting, interpreting, and presenting both numerical and qualitative data. Our faculty provides supervision across diverse research domains, including:

Workplace equality and inclusion - examining various inequalities, in-work poverty, compensation distribution, and gender/ethnicity pay disparities.
Workplace governance systems - studying ethical business practices, professional conduct, organizational representation, and employment conflicts.
Employment quality and standards - analyzing work hours, technological impacts, work-life integration, professional development, and labor rights including contemporary slavery issues.
Environmental sustainability - investigating eco-friendly employment, public service structures, privatization effects across essential services, and climate policy implications.
Occupational health - focusing on pandemic workplace safety, psychological wellbeing, and stress management in professional environments.

Qualification Requirements

Applicants should have: A taught Master's degree, with a minimum average of 60% in all areas of assessment (e.g. Merit or above), in a generic subject area relevant to the subject matter of the proposed research project, and/or A First Class or Second Class, First Division (Upper Second Class) Honours degree in a subject area relevant to the proposed research project. IELTS 6.5 overall with minimum 6.5 in each skill
